GECF final declaration puts focus on Iran president’s proposals

Tehran, IRNA – Heads of State of the Gas Exporting Countries Forum (GECF) issued a final declaration at the end of their 7th summit in Algeria, placing emphasis on proposals put forward by the Iranian president, including adopting new policies aimed at breaking monopoly on gas trade technologies.

The GECF heads of state concluded their daylong summit on Saturday in the Algerian capital, Algiers, approving the declaration “in the spirit of solidarity and cooperation”, emphasizing the importance of several proposals which Iran’s President Ebrahim Raisi put forward, according to a report by the IRNA on Sunday.

Raisi said that the world is facing numerous challenges which require integration among governments to enable them to take the path of development.

“It is essential that the GECF member states adopt new policies to create conditions for breaking the monopoly on technologies related to gas trade”, he noted, proposing that the GECF secretariat creates a mechanism that will help member states exchange technical knowhow and experiences in the gas industry.

The Iranian president also said that his country’s regional strategy is to increase the production and export of natural gas and help raise regional countries’ access to this valuable and clean fuel. He announced Iran’s readiness to turn into an energy hub in the region and provide a safe route for the distribution and transit of gas between producers and consumption markets.

Participants in the GECF summit, which brought together representatives from the member states as well as observer and guest countries along with OPEC and several regional energy blocs, expressed resolve to “promote natural gas as an abundant, affordable, flexible and reliable energy source”, according to the text of the Algiers Declaration.

“The leaders welcomed the inauguration in Algiers of the headquarters of the Gas Research Institute to expand cooperation in, inter alia, natural gas technologies, scientifically-guided research, and innovation-led capacity-building for the benefit of GECF Member Countries”, the declaration said.
